<div dir="ltr">Hi everyone, <div><br></div><div>I am student working on the WebGrass project for this GSoC. I was making the dialog boxes of different modules in grass. While doing this, I come across a problem. I am using the xml files of these modules using command (<span style="background-color:rgb(255,255,255)">x.module <span style="color:rgb(48,48,48)">--interface-description</span><span style="color:rgb(48,48,48)">). </span> </span>When a dialog box opens, there are many options. For example, for the v.buffer (v.buffer --interface-description), there is option for "input vector map" and "output vector map" (<a href="https://cloud.githubusercontent.com/assets/12744703/16241571/e05a7402-380b-11e6-9701-9c211da3ebc3.png">screenshot</a>). When you see the <a href="https://gist.github.com/mayank33/5dccaa844787abee280c0291a1561ed2">xml</a>, then you will notice "input vector map" is under <a href="https://gist.github.com/mayank33/5dccaa844787abee280c0291a1561ed2#file-buffer-xml-L12">label</a> tag and "output vector map" is under <a href="https://gist.github.com/mayank33/5dccaa844787abee280c0291a1561ed2#file-buffer-xml-L95">description</a> tag. Though both are shown at same place in dialog box. Same thing is done at many places in different modules. I want to know whether it is on purpose or some kind of error as this makes the parsing of xml for generation of dialog box, a little bit tricky. At some places, description tag is used and somewhere label tag is used. Also any help in this regard(parsing) will be highly appreciated.</div><div><br></div><div style="font-size:12.8px">Mayank Agrawal</div><div style="font-size:12.8px">Lab for Spatial Informatics</div><div style="font-size:12.8px">IIIT Hyderabad</div><div style="font-size:12.8px">Hyderabad</div><br><div class="gmail_extra"><br><div class="gmail_quote">On Sun, Jun 19, 2016 at 4:14 PM, Mayank Agrawal <span dir="ltr"><<a href="mailto:mayankagrawal333@gmail.com" target="_blank">mayankagrawal333@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><span style="font-size:12.8px">Hi everyone,</span><div style="font-size:12.8px"><br></div><div style="font-size:12.8px">I am Mayank Agrawal and I am working on webgrass. </div><div style="font-size:12.8px"><br></div><div style="font-size:12.8px">my report for the week 4<br><br><span style="font-family:Ubuntu;font-size:12.8px;line-height:12.8px">Q. What did you get done this week?</span></div><div style="font-size:12.8px"><ul><li style="margin-left:15px">parsing of the xml files</li><li style="margin-left:15px">Creation of new window.</li><li style="margin-left:15px">working UI of module windows.</li><li style="margin-left:15px">calling and clicking of modules.</li></ul><div><a href="https://github.com/rashadkm/webgrass/pull/10/commits/b5f1ff39b315a819af2a95a88cf6e69f3a2c2a70" target="_blank">commit</a></div></div><div style="font-size:12.8px">​<br></div><div style="font-size:12.8px"><a href="https://trac.osgeo.org/grass/attachment/wiki/GSoC/2016/WebGrass/ModuleUI1.png" target="_blank">Screenshot</a></div><div style="font-size:12.8px"><br></div><div style="font-size:12.8px">Status<b> </b>- Clicking on the different modules and generation of UI</div><div style="font-size:12.8px"><br></div><div style="font-size:12.8px"><span style="font-size:12.8px">Q. What do you plan on doing next week?</span></div><div style="font-size:12.8px"><ul><li style="margin-left:15px">There is some inconsistency with parsing for generation of different modules. Removing those.</li></ul></div><div style="font-size:12.8px"><br></div><div style="font-size:12.8px"><span style="font-size:12.8px">Q. Are you blocked on anything?</span></div><div style="font-size:12.8px"><span style="font-size:12.8px">Not rite now. </span></div><div style="font-size:12.8px"><span style="font-size:12.8px"><br></span></div><div style="font-size:12.8px"><span style="font-size:12.8px"><br></span></div><div style="font-size:12.8px">Mayank Agrawal</div><div style="font-size:12.8px">Lab for Spatial Informatics</div><div style="font-size:12.8px">IIIT Hyderabad</div><div style="font-size:12.8px">Hyderabad</div><br><br><br><img width="0" height="0" src="data:image/gif;base64,R0lGODlhAQABAIAAAAAAAP///yH5BAEAAAAALAAAAAABAAEAAAIBRAA7"></div>
</blockquote></div><br></div><img width="0" height="0" class="mailtrack-img" src="https://mailtrack.io/trace/mail/b50e0f3b3c6db2ceddc909c5c74d97ddedc25f94232327.png"></div>